大数跨境
0
0

Tkinter 库安装教程:轻松开启 GUI 开发之旅

Tkinter 库安装教程:轻松开启 GUI 开发之旅 码途钥匙
2025-04-08
0


Tkinter 作为 Python 的标准图形用户界面(GUI)库,凭借简单易用的特性,帮助开发者快速搭建跨平台桌面应用。大多数情况下,Python 安装时已默认集成 Tkinter,但因系统环境差异,部分用户可能仍需手动安装。下面,就为大家介绍在不同操作系统中安装 Tkinter 的方法。


Windows 系统安装


1. 检查 Python 安装


首先,确认系统中已安装 Python。通过按下键盘上的Windows + R键,打开 “运行” 对话框,输入 “cmd” 并回车,打开命令提示符窗口。在窗口中输入python --version,若显示 Python 版本号,说明 Python 已安装;若提示 “python 不是内部或外部命令”,则需前往Python 官方网站下载并安装 Python。建议选择最新稳定版本,安装过程中勾选 “Add Python to PATH”,以便在命令行中直接使用 Python 命令。

2. 验证 Tkinter 是否可用


在命令提示符窗口中输入python,进入 Python 交互环境,再输入以下代码:

    
    
    
import tkintertkinter._test()


若弹出一个简单的 Tkinter 窗口,表明 Tkinter 已安装且可用。若出现错误提示,通常是由于安装 Python 时未勾选 Tk/Tcl 组件。重新运行 Python 安装程序,选择 “Modify”(修改),在安装选项中找到 “Tk/Tcl and IDLE”,确保其被勾选,然后完成安装。


macOS 系统安装

1. 检查 Python 与 Tkinter


macOS 系统通常预装 Python 2,但 Tkinter 的最佳使用环境是 Python 3。打开 “终端” 应用,输入python3 --version,检查 Python 3 是否安装。若未安装,可从Python 官方网站下载安装包进行安装。安装完成后,在终端输入以下命令验证 Tkinter

    
    
    
python3 -c "import tkinter; tkinter._test()"


若能弹出 Tkinter 示例窗口,说明 Tkinter 已成功安装。

2. 处理可能的问题


部分 macOS 用户可能会遇到 Tkinter 无法正常工作的问题,这可能是由于系统自带的 Tk 版本较低。此时,可以使用 Homebrew 包管理器来安装最新版的 Tk。首先,确保已安装 Homebrew,若未安装,可在终端执行以下命令进行安装:

    
    
    
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"


安装好 Homebrew 后,在终端输入以下命令安装 Tk

    
    
    
brew install tcl-tk


安装完成后,Tkinter 即可正常使用。



Linux 系统安装


不同 Linux 发行版安装 Tkinter 的方式略有不同。下面以常见的 UbuntuCentOS 为例进行介绍。

Ubuntu 系统


打开 “终端”,使用以下命令安装 Tkinter 依赖:

    
    
    
sudo apt-get updatesudo apt-get install python3-tk


安装完成后,可通过运行以下命令验证 Tkinter 是否安装成功:

    
    
    
python3 -c "import tkinter; tkinter._test()"


CentOS 系统


CentOS 系统中,使用以下命令安装 Tkinter

    
    
    
sudo yum install python36-tkinter


由于 CentOS 默认软件源中的 Tkinter 版本可能较旧,若需要安装最新版本,可启用 EPEL 源后再进行安装。安装完成后,同样通过上述验证命令确认 Tkinter 是否可用。





通过以上步骤,无论你使用哪种操作系统,都能顺利安装 Tkinter 库,开启 Python GUI 开发之旅。在安装过程中若遇到问题,可查阅相关技术论坛或社区,获取更多帮助与支持。

【声明】内容源于网络
0
0
码途钥匙
欢迎来到 Python 学习乐园!这里充满活力,分享前沿实用知识技术。新手或开发者,都能找到价值。一起在这个平台,以 Python 为引,开启成长之旅,探索代码世界,共同进步。携手 Python,共赴精彩未来,快来加入我们吧!
内容 992
粉丝 0
码途钥匙 欢迎来到 Python 学习乐园!这里充满活力,分享前沿实用知识技术。新手或开发者,都能找到价值。一起在这个平台,以 Python 为引,开启成长之旅,探索代码世界,共同进步。携手 Python,共赴精彩未来,快来加入我们吧!
总阅读1
粉丝0
内容992